About this coordinate

Matthew 24:21:4 is a BCV:P reference — Book · Chapter · Verse · Word Position. It addresses word 4 of Matthew 24:21, so the Greek word θλῖψις (thlipsis) can be cited, linked and studied at exactly this position rather than somewhere in the verse. In the Biblical Knowledge Coordinate System the same position is written Matt.24.21.W4, which extends further down to each syllable (Matt.24.21.W4.S1) and character.
